They are portable, inexpensive and easy to utilize. The only adverse point concerning area heating systems is that if used incorrectly they can turn a comfortable enhancement into a dangerous or harmful mistake. Here at Fritts Heat & Air we wan na ensure everyone takes appropriate safety measures when making use of a portable heating system.
Right here are a couple of to stay safe this winter season. Space heaters are simply an added bonus and must supplement your furnace. Don't rely on them as your primary resource of warmth due to the fact that some area heating units make use of exposed home heating sources that get to 100 F or more. Most of heating systems need roughly 3 feet of room around them when they're warm or in use.

Never set an area heating system on a carpeting or a rug. Use hard floors or a fire-proof surface when possible. Running an area heating unit continuous is a huge danger. You can possibly get too hot the circuitry or circuit creating significant concerns. If your room heating system makes use of gas or oil, running it continually can bring about carbon monoxide gas poisoning.
Establish a timer, or acquire a heating unit with an integrated thermostat. Whatever, do not leave a space heater unattended. Transform it off prior to you leave the space. As a general guideline, you should have 10 watts of power for every single square foot of floor area in the room you're home heating.
The area heating system draws a lot more from electrical energy or fuel when it's too tiny for a space, which creates a larger fire danger. Also, a space heating system that's as well large can get too hot a space and cause burning. The possibility of this occurring is low yet it's still a danger not worth taking.
If you notice these problems, get to out to a certified repair individual or change the space heating system quickly. When you utilize expansion cords and power strips with a space heater, you might overload circuits.

Cooling and heating firms connect these home appliances to furnaces. The humidifiers send water vapor with the duct. They're managed by a humidistat, which is similar to a thermostat, to automatically manage the quantity of moisture in the air. You can establish it at the degree comfy to you and it will certainly keep it throughout the heating season.
Central humidifiers use the concepts of evaporative cooling. They blow air through a pad saturated with water to raise moisture levels. Heating firms run a water line to the humidifier and a drainline right into your home's pipes to make sure that they drain and load immediately. The fresh water flows over the absorbing pad and the air blowing with it evaporates a few of the water.
